Overview
Plasma bag boxes are critical components in healthcare and laboratory settings, designed to safely store and transport plasma bags. These containers ensure that plasma remains uncontaminated and undamaged during handling. They are commonly used in blood banks, hospitals, and research facilities where the integrity of plasma is paramount. The design of plasma bag boxes often includes features such as stackability and lightweight construction, making them easy to handle and store. They are typically made from high-quality plastics like polypropylene or polystyrene, which provide durability and resistance to sterilization processes.
Structure and Working Principle
Plasma bag boxes are usually rectangular or square in shape, with a lid that securely fits to prevent contamination. Some models include dividers or compartments to hold multiple plasma bags separately, reducing the risk of cross-contamination. The boxes may also feature handles or grips for easy transportation. The working principle revolves around providing a sterile and protective environment for plasma bags. The materials used are non-reactive and resistant to chemicals, ensuring that the plasma remains safe from external contaminants. Additionally, some boxes are designed to maintain a stable internal temperature, further protecting the plasma during transit.
Key Features
Durability is a standout feature of plasma bag boxes, as they are often subjected to frequent handling and sterilization. The materials used are chosen for their ability to withstand autoclaving or other sterilization methods without degrading. Lightweight construction ensures ease of use, while stackability optimizes storage space in busy medical environments. Another key feature is the sterility maintenance. Many boxes are designed to be airtight or include seals that prevent contaminants from entering. This is crucial for preserving the quality of plasma, which can be sensitive to environmental factors.
Application Areas
Plasma bag boxes are primarily used in blood banks, where they store and transport donated plasma. Hospitals also rely on these boxes for internal distribution of plasma to various departments. Research laboratories use them to handle plasma samples for experiments and testing. In addition to medical settings, plasma bag boxes are sometimes used in disaster relief operations, where the safe transport of blood products is critical. Their robust design makes them suitable for use in challenging environments.
Maintenance and Precautions
Regular inspection of plasma bag boxes is essential to ensure they remain in good condition. Cracks or damage can compromise sterility, so damaged boxes should be replaced immediately. Cleaning and sterilization should be performed according to manufacturer guidelines to maintain effectiveness. Precautions include avoiding exposure to extreme temperatures, which can warp the plastic or affect the integrity of the plasma. Proper labeling is also important to ensure that plasma bags are easily identifiable and traceable within the storage system.
